Transaction 32bec603c47b49a842b27dd42191f93c6de6a4962902d2b99fe0cf21371275e4

2 Input
2 Outputs
  • 32bec603c47b49a842b27dd42191f93c6de6a4962902d2b99fe0cf21371275e4:0
  • value  13900000
    address  14RPPaPyWza4hvat8Bht9MhqJtqhmeiyTa
  • 32bec603c47b49a842b27dd42191f93c6de6a4962902d2b99fe0cf21371275e4:1
  • value  14663214
    address  3GYYafvKnBaiRjm6Ji56gBCbQHesPCMvwA